Huhehu depression is a secondary structural unit in the Hailaer-Tamucage Basin, The recent exploration shows that, Huhehu depression has good exploration potential and it is a new substitute field for hydrocarbon resources in Hailaer-Tamucage Basin. Recently,the hydrocarbon exploration in Huhehu depression gets more and more attention.This article is stand on the petroleum exploration practice of Huhehu depression. Under the study of basin tectonic framework, through established the sequence stratigraphic framework of the study area, sequence structure and sedimentary system distribution and evolution were analyzed. distribution and prediction model of sedimentary sand bodies were built , also connected with hydrocarbon accumulation condition,exploration achievements and the hydrocarbon reservoirs distribution rule shows by it, the hydrocarbon accumulation model were built.that the hydrocarbon exploration favorable areas were predicted. This has some practical significance to the next hydrocarbon exploration of Huhehu depression,also has theoretical and production significance to continental fault basin sequence stratigraphyand sequence stratigraphy applied in hydrocarbon exploration and other filed.This article takes latest development of sequence stratigraphy as theoretical basis.On the comprehensive research of seismic,drilling,logging,cores and paleontology in the whole of depression, also based on the characteristics of sequence boundary,we could divided cretaceous of Huhehu depression into three first-order sequence,five second-order sequence and eight third-order sequence.We had summarized the genetic type of sequence boundary and sequence stratigraphic framework characteristics of lake basin's different parts in this areas.On the base of isochronous stratigraphic framework,we had determined the study area main development five sedimentary systems,as alluvial fan,fan delta,braided river delta,sublacustrine fan,lake and so on,also had contrasted and analyzed the characteristics of typical sand body,and comprehensive application information of sandbody,heavy minerals,paleogeomorphic,seismic foreset reflection characteristics and so on,detailed study the deposit source of depression in different angles and different levels.We had system researched the space time distribution rule of sedimentary system,built the stabilized development model, intuitionistic reconstruction the process of sedimentary evolution.The characteristics and evolution of tectonic were analyzed in this article. Huhehu depression has three tectonic movements. From down to up separately is early extensional faulted depression stage, middle post-fault thermal subsidence fault sag stage, late depression stage. Two sets of fault system are developed in longitudinal direction: lower extensional faulted system mainly is NEE, NE and NNE; upper strike-slip fault system mainly is NNE and NNW. Multi-stages tectonic movement determines more structural style coexistent, the different fracture feature and combination form of this two fault system shows that the formation period's stress characteristic had obvious differences.The results show that contemporaneous sedimentary faulting has many assemble pattern in Huhehu depression, contains parallel fault terrace type,broom type,forked type and fault accommodation zone ect fault system,this bring up complicated tectonic paleogeomorphic and slope-break system of lake basin,and the model of sedimentary and accumulation of sandbody dispersion system in the depression were strictly controlled by their. This revealed that contemporaneous sedimentary faulting had controlled the sedimentary system distribution and sandbody dispersion style,also discussed the relationship between sandbody controlled by codeposition faulted slope fold belt and hydrocarbon reservoir enrichment.On the base of structure background, Huhehu depression was decided into fault controlled steep slope zone, gentle slope fault terrace zone and depression zone. On this way, different tectonic units established different sequence architecture patterns and sedimentary system composing model. and this special types of sequence architecture patterns also decided that different tectonic units had oil-gas formation model.On the base of sequence stratigraphic analysis,we studied hydrocarbon accumulation condition characteristics of Huhehu depression by petroleum geology theory, contains source rock characteristics,reservoir characteristics,source reservoir cap assemblage characteristics,hydrocarbon migration and aggregation characteristics,trapping characteristics and other field in hydrocarbon accumulation process, analyzed the controlling factors of hydrocarbon distribution pattern and enrichment,built the hydrocarbon accumulation model. predicted three favorable hydrocarbon exploration zone: northwest gentle slope zone,southern depression zone and southeast steep slope zone.We had determined three concrete exploration target.
